The Federal Court has rejected Najib Razak’s request  to delay the hearing of his final appeal in his attempt to overturn his conviction in the RM42 million SRC International Sdn Bhd (SRC) corruption appeal.  The hearing would go ahead on March 15-16. If this appeal fails, and if the Federal Court does not allow a stay of execution, Najib goes to jail. 

Can he get a Royal Pardon?  Short answer YES. The Agong decides who and when and how he wants to give out royal pardons.

Will Najib Razak,  who has been found guilty on seven corruption counts and sentenced to up to 12 years in prison and fined RM$210  million, go to jail for his crimes?  The appellate court approved the defense’s request to stay the conviction pending a final appeal sometime in May this year.  Until then, Najib,  will remain out on bail.  If the final appeal fails in May,  Najib would have exhausted the court process and will go to jail. 

Then,  his only way forward is a pardon. Translation: If the Umno-led Barisan Nasional is in government, will  Najib Razak get a pardon?
